Ref. (formerly BlackArt Gastown) is a travelling gallery whose work is dedicated to modelling ethical engagement of African and Black self identified creatives through collective methods of art-making, curation, presentation, programming, archival and ethnographic study, community facilitation and artist development. Ref. acts as an intermediary bridging Black and African emerging and mid career practitioners with institutions, funding or resources in kind and mentorship. In acknowledgement of the absence of Black cultural production in Canadian art landscape both historical and ongoing, Ref. aims to create space and make visible curatorial and programming initiatives.

In 2020 Ref. (formerly Black Art Gastown) fulfilled successful collaborations with the following institutions:

Massy Arts Society “Quilt of Hope”

Vancouver Art Gallery “Where do we go from here?”

Museum of Anthropology “Sankofa”
